What Year Is It According To Islamic Calendar. In muslim countries, it is also sometimes denoted as h from its arabic form ( سَنَة هِجْرِيَّة, abbreviated ھ ). The islamic new year, which is the first day of the islamic calendar, dates back to the migration of the prophet muhammad and his followers from mecca to medina in the year.
